AC Problems We Fix Every Day in Palm Beach
Whatever your system is doing — or not doing — we've seen it before. Here are the most common AC repair calls we handle across Palm Beach County.
Running But Not Cooling
Your system is on, the fan is blowing, but the house stays hot. This is usually a refrigerant leak, a dirty evaporator coil, or a failing compressor. It needs a proper diagnosis — not a guess.
Won't Turn On at All
Total shutdown. Could be a tripped breaker, a failed capacitor, a bad contactor, or a thermostat issue. Most of these are fast fixes once we find the cause.
Water Dripping Inside
Water pooling around your indoor unit or dripping from the ceiling means the condensate drain line is clogged. In Palm Beach's humidity, algae builds up in these lines constantly. We flush it out and treat it.
Tripping the Breaker
If your AC trips the breaker more than once, stop resetting it. A failing compressor, a short in the wiring, or a dirty coil can all cause this. Running it keeps making things worse.
Making Loud Noises
Banging, squealing, rattling, grinding — none of these are normal. Turn the system off and call us. Running a unit that's making mechanical noises usually turns a repair into a replacement.
Short Cycling
Turns on, runs for a minute, shuts off, repeats. This burns energy, wears parts out fast, and usually means a refrigerant issue, an oversized system, or an electrical problem.

AC Repair in Palm Beach Is Different From Anywhere Else
South Florida is hard on HVAC systems in ways that catch a lot of homeowners off guard — especially if you moved here from up north.
Your system runs 10 to 11 months a year.
In most of the country, HVAC systems get a break. In Palm Beach, there isn't one. That much runtime means parts wear out faster, refrigerant depletes faster, and drain lines clog more often.
Salt air eats coils.
The closer you are to the Intracoastal or the ocean, the faster salt air corrodes the aluminum fins on your condenser coil. Systems in El Cid, on South Ocean Boulevard, and in the buildings along Flagler Drive see this more than anywhere. Regular coil cleaning and coil coating extends the life of a system significantly out here.
Humidity clogs drain lines.
Palm Beach pulls more moisture out of the air than you'd believe. That water has to go somewhere — and when the condensate drain line gets blocked, it overflows. We flush drain lines on almost every service call here.
Older homes have older systems.
A lot of Palm Beach's housing stock — particularly in the historic neighborhoods — was built in the 1950s, 60s, and 70s. Some of those systems have been running a long time. Some have had ductwork added in pieces over the decades. We know how to work in these homes.
